To be clear: I’ve reached out to my doctor with this question and she doesn’t seem overly concerned, but as someone who has also faced medical discrimination because of my weight (not from this particular doctor but still yk anxiety) - I am asking for others experiences.
I started back up on adderall but this time I’m on the xr formula. It’s been amazing for my job and home life and helped with a lot of the issues ADHD has caused for me.
I can’t seem to find a clear answer online, when I look up anything with weight loss and adderall it always comes up with misuse articles about people using it to speed run their weight loss.
So my question would be that if I am 215lbs and was 230ish right before restarting my prescription a month ago, is this a normal amount of weight loss? 15lbs down in a month feels like a lot to me. I’m not unhappy about it, but it seems a little fast. I have a very decreased appetite due to the meds, something that wasn’t too much of an issue on the immediate release version for me. I try to eat when I can, but I also have a very time demanding career and don’t get time to eat a lot during the day, until ’m usually reminded that that’s even an option. I definitely need to get better with quick snacks so if you guys also have some suggestions for that pls drop those too
